										<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p class="summary">TEHRAN (<a href="https://www.irannewsdaily.com/">Iran News</a>) – Hassan Ruholamin, an Iranian artist whose paintings mostly revolve around stories from the history of Islam, has portrayed in his new artwork the arrival of Hazrat Masumeh (SA) in Qom.</p>
<p>For the past few days, he has been in Qom at the shrine of Hazrat Masumeh (SA), portraying the story of her arrival to the Iranian city on Rabi’ al-Awwal 23, 201 on the Islamic calendar (October 23, 816 CE).</p>
<p>The artwork is scheduled to be unveiled on October 25 during a celebration marking the anniversary of the event.</p>
<p>In 815 CE, Hazrat Masumeh (SA) and a large number of her relatives embarked on a journey from Medina to meet her brother, Imam Reza (AS), in Khorasan.</p>
<p>Due to his hostility toward Shias, Abbasid caliph Mamun ordered his men to stop them in Saveh, a city near Qom, home to a large population of Shias.</p>
<p>Mamun’s soldiers killed a large number of the companions of Hazrat Masumeh (SA) in Saveh, where she was taken ill. Therefore, she decided to take refuge in Qom.</p>
<p>Shia Muslims in Qom gave Hazrat Masumeh (SA) and her companions a very warm welcome upon their arrival in the city. However, she was in critical condition and ultimately met her death on November 9, 816 CE. She is buried in Qom.</p>
<p>Earlier in the Fars region, Mamun had killed her brothers Hazrat Ahmad ibn Musa (AS) and Seyyed Alaeddin Hossein (AS).</p>
<p>The Imam Reza (AS) International Foundation for Culture and Arts donated a copy of Ruholamin’s painting “Condition of Tawheed (Monotheism)” to the holy shrine of Hazrat Masumeh (SA) in June.</p>
<p>“Condition of Tawheed” has been created based on the Hadith of Silsilah al-Dhahab (The Hadith of the Golden Chain).</p>
<p>The 2 X 3.6-meter oil painting was made public during a special ceremony at the Ministry of Culture and Islamic Guidance in Tehran on May 12.</p>
<p>The artwork depicts the story of the Hadith of the Golden Chain narrated by Imam Reza (AS) upon his arrival at the northeastern Iranian town of Neyshabur.</p>
<p>The hadith refers to the continuity of spiritual authority that is passed down from the Prophet Muhammad (S) to Imam Ali (AS), the first Imam of the Shia, and through each of the successive Imams to Imam Reza (AS).</p>
<p>This painting has been commissioned by the Imam Reza (AS) International Foundation for Culture and Arts based on a contract with Ruholamin. Four other paintings about the life of the Imam will be created under this contract.</p>

										<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>TEHRAN (<a href="https://www.irannewsdaily.com/">Iran News</a>) – Concurrent with National Industry and Mine Day, the production line of washcoat (kind of catalyst used in the auto industry) was inaugurated in Qom in presence of Deputy Minister of Industry, Mine and Trade and Head of Industrial Development  and Renovation Organization of Iran (IDRO)Mr. Mohsen Salehinia.</p>
<p>In the inaugural ceremony held at Mobadel Khodro Pak Company in the Mahmoudabad Industrial Town of Qom, Salehinia said national auto industry in the sanctions and pandemic era has taken proper steps in line with deepening indigenization of products that production of auto parts is important and washcoat is an example for these efforts.</p>
<p>Head of IDRO referred to the plans of the auto-makers for production of 1.2m vehicles and expressed hope with the new government, the climate would be provided for improving the quality and quantity in the auto industry as the locomotive of the national industries, and the country would witness more development and satisfaction of consumers.</p>
<p>Meanwhile addressing the ceremony, the CEO of Iran Automotive Industrial Group (IAPCO) Mr. Saeed Reza Panah said that in accordance with the social responsibilities regarding the protection of environment and reducing pollution, the production of washcoat has been carried out as one of the main projects of Mobadel Khodro Pak Company.</p>
<p>He added that in the first year, production of 4m euros of washcoat equaling to 110b tomans of saving forex will be materialized due to indigenization of this part, and the figure will definitely grow with the increase in the production.</p>
<p>During his one-day travel to Qom Province, Mr. Salehinia also visited several companies like Zarnama SISU Polymer, Ayandeh Negar, Barazesh Sanaat and Arian Innovative Tool Manufacturers.</p>

										<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p class="summary">TEHRAN (<a href="https://www.irannewsdaily.com/">Iran News</a>) – As announced by a provincial official, 15 idle mines are planned to be revived in Iran’s central Qom province by the end of the current Iranian calendar year (March 20, 2022).</p>
<p>Mahmoud Sijani, the head of the province’s Industry, Mining, and Trade Department, said, “When reviving the idle mines, the issues of processing and value-added are of high significance, and given the existence of 45 idle mines in the province, it is hoped that we can revive these mines through a long-term planning.”</p>
<p>In terms of paying facilities to the mines, the official stated that there is no limit in this due, and 11 trillion rials (about $262 million) of facilities will be paid in the current year.</p>
<p>The head of Iranian Mines and Mining Industries Development and Renovation Organization (IMIDRO) has announced that 253 idle small-scale mines were revived throughout the country in the previous Iranian calendar year.</p>
<p>According to Vajihollah Jafari, the plan for reviving idle mines in the previous year was realized by 126 percent.</p>
<p>Saying that the mentioned mines have been reactivated as part of a comprehensive program for reviving idle small mines across the country, Jafari also announced that under the framework of the mentioned program 200 mines are planned to be put back into operation in the current year.</p>
<p>The official noted that the successful implementation of the said program in the previous year was achieved despite the problems created by the outbreak of coronavirus.</p>
<p>Emphasizing that the above goals have been achieved as a result of productive cooperation among the Industry, Mining, and Trade Ministry, provincial industry organizations, Iran Mines houses, and private sector companies, Jafari noted that since the beginning of the program in March 2019 up to the end of the previous year, 303 mines have been revived.</p>
<p>As reported, under the framework of the mentioned program, 672 idle mines were identified and prioritized in the previous year, and diagnostic procedures were performed on 194 mines to determine the reasons for the halt in their production.</p>
<p>The program, which has been at the forefront of IMIDRO&#8217;s missions over the past two years, is being pursued in several provinces.</p>
<p>Khodadad Gharibpour, IMIDRO’s former head had mentioned this plan as one of the most significant plans of “Resistance Economy”, saying that IMIDRO is strongly determined to carry out it.</p>
<p>Reviving the small mines not only is a major step for supporting and boosting domestic production, it also plays a significant role in job creation throughout the country, Gharibpour said back in June 2020.</p>
<p>Following this program, so far various small-scale mines including chromite, manganese, hematite, and dolomite, iron ore, copper, and construction stone mines have been surveyed by monitoring and diagnosing the problems of the mines and providing solutions for resolving their issues.</p>

										<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>TEHRAN (<a href="https://irannewsdaily.com/" target="_blank" rel="noopener noreferrer">Iran News</a>) – Ayatollah Ebrahim Amini, member of Iran’s Expediency Council, passed away on Friday at the age of 95.</p>
<div class="item-body">
<div class="item-text">
<p>‎After suffering a long period of illness, the prominent religious scholar passed away in a hospital in the central city of Qom.</p>
<p>Ayatollah Amini was born in 1925 in Najafabad, Esfahan province. ‎</p>
<p>Finishing his primary studies in Najafabad, he joined the Islamic Seminary of Esfahan in ‎‎1942. After completing his curriculum of religious studies in Esfahan, he joined the Islamic ‎Seminary of Qom in 1947, where he studied jurisprudence and principles under the tutorship of most eminent religious scholars of that period. ‎</p>
<p>Because of his special attitude and inclination towards the ‎sciences of psychology, child psychology, education and training, family-rights, family-ethics ‎, and the narrations of Prophet Muhammad and the Infallible Imams, he pursued advanced ‎studies and research in these areas.‎</p>
<p>He also wrote many miscellaneous articles written on various issues, including ideological, ‎political, social, ethical, and educational topics for presentation at national and international ‎seminars and conferences. ‎</p>
<p>Ayatollah Amini was also the secretary-general of the office of the Educational Research Centre of the Assembly of Experts, a ‎member of the Academic Council of the Islamic Seminary of Qom and the chief of Cultural ‎Affairs, a member of the board of trustees of the World Centre for Islamic Sciences, a ‎member of the board of trustees Imam al-Sadiq University in Tehran and a member of the ‎Supreme Council of the Ahl al-Bayt World Assembly.‎</p>

										<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>TEHRAN (<a href="https://irannewsdaily.com/" target="_blank" rel="noopener noreferrer">Iran News</a>) – External Affairs Minister S Jaishankar on Sunday said efforts are underway for the return of Indian pilgrims from Iran&#8217;s Qom city and follow up arrangements are being discussed with the Iranian authorities.</p>
<div class="item-body">
<div class="item-text">
<p>Jaishankar also noted that no case of coronavirus has been reported among the Indian fishermen in Iran, according to India Today.</p>
<p>He named the issues as the Indian embassy&#8217;s top priority in Tehran.</p>
<p>The Indian embassy in Iran is in close touch with Indian fishermen and no case of coronavirus has been reported among them, he elaborated.</p>
<p>Iran is among the countries grappling with the outbreak of coronavirus.</p>
<p>As of March 9, the novel coronavirus, officially known as COVID-19, has infected 110,092 people in 109 countries, claiming 3,831 lives.</p>
<p>Mainland China reported 43 new confirmed coronavirus cases on Monday, putting the country’s total infections at 80,738 and a death toll of 3,120.</p>

										<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>TEHRAN (<a href="https://irannewsdaily.com/" target="_blank" rel="noopener noreferrer">Iran News</a>) &#8211; Iran on Saturday reported one more death among 10 new cases of coronavirus, bringing the total number of deaths in the country to five – the highest of any country outside the Far East.</p>
<div class="itemcontent">
<p>Since it emerged in December, the virus has killed 2,345 people in China, the epicenter of the epidemic, and 16 elsewhere in the world.</p>
<p>The COVID-19 outbreak in Iran first surfaced on Wednesday, when authorities said it claimed the lives of two elderly people in Qom, a holy city south of the capital.</p>
<p>They were the first confirmed deaths from the disease in the Middle East.</p>
<p>&#8220;We have 10 new confirmed cases of COVID-19,&#8221; Iran&#8217;s Health Ministry spokesman Kianoush Jahanpour told national television on Saturday.</p>
<p>Jahanpour said that of the 10 newly detected cases, two were in the capital of Tehran and eight were in the city of Qom. He said the two patients in the capital had visited Qom or had links with the city.</p>
<p>&#8220;One of the new cases has unfortunately passed away,&#8221; he added, noting that eight of them had been hospitalized in Qom and two in Tehran, without specifying where the death occurred.</p>
<p>The latest cases take to 28 the total number of confirmed coronavirus infections in Iran.</p>
<p>The outbreak emerged in the lead-up to a parliamentary election on Friday. State media said the disease had failed to dampen &#8220;the revolutionary zeal of Qom&#8217;s people&#8221; to turn out to vote.</p>
<p>Iranians have been snapping up surgical face masks in a bid to avoid catching the virus.</p>
<p>The Health Ministry said tests had been carried out on 785 suspected coronavirus cases since the outbreak began.</p>
<p>&#8220;Most of the cases are either Qom residents or have a history of coming and going from Qom to other cities,&#8221; its spokesman said.</p>
<p>All of those who lost their lives are believed to be Iranian citizens.</p>
<p>Iran has yet to confirm the origin of the outbreak, but one official speculated that it was brought in by Chinese workers.</p>
<p>&#8220;The coronavirus epidemic has started in the country,&#8221; IRNA quoted the Health Ministry&#8217;s Minoo Mohraz as saying.</p>
<p>&#8220;Since those infected in Qom had no contact with the Chinese &#8230; the source is probably Chinese workers who work in Qom and have traveled to China,&#8221; she added.</p>
<p>A Chinese company has been building a solar power plant in Qom.</p>
<p>Qom is a popular religious destination and a center of learning and religious studies for Shia Muslims from inside Iran, as well as Iraq, India, Lebanon, Pakistan, Afghanistan,L and Azerbaijan.</p>
<p>Concerns over the spread of the virus, which originated in central China, prompted authorities in Iran to close all schools and seminaries in Qom.</p>
<p>Iran had recently evacuated 60 Iranian students from Wuhan, the Chinese city at the epicenter of the epidemic. The students were quarantined upon their return to Iran and were discharged after 14 days without any health problems.</p>
<p>Iran has suspended all passenger flights with China for the past two weeks, allowing only cargo flights.</p>
<p>Iran’s civil aviation spokesman Reza Jafarzadeh said on Thursday that the “cargo flights, if necessary, are under supervision, and controls imposed by the Health Ministry are carried out.”</p>
<p>Following the announcement of the deaths, neighboring Iraq on Thursday banned travel to and from the Islamic Republic.</p>
<p>The Iraqi Health Ministry announced that people in Iran were barred from entering the country &#8220;until further notice.&#8221;</p>
<p>Kuwait&#8217;s national carrier Kuwait Airways also announced it would suspend all flights to Iran.</p>
<p>In Turkey, Health Minister Fahrettin Koca said officials have started to screen travelers arriving from Iran at border gates and are refusing entry to anyone with signs of illness. He also said Iranians who have traveled to Qom in the past 14 days will be refused entry.</p>
<p>Saudi Arabia announced that citizens and residents of the kingdom are not permitted to travel to Iran following the spread of the virus there. Anyone previously in Iran will only be permitted entry to the country after the 14-day incubation period of the virus has passed.</p>
<p>The decision, while not specifically mentioning Iranian nationals, directly impacts thousands of Iranians who travel to Mecca and Medina for Islamic pilgrimages, effectively barring them from entry to Saudi Arabia.</p>

<p class="summary introtext">TEHRAN (<a href="https://irannewsdaily.com/" target="_blank" rel="noopener noreferrer">Iran News</a>) – The police forces of Qom Province have intercepted 1,006 kilograms of illicit drugs on Dilijan-Salafchegan road.</p>
</div>
<div class="item-body">
<div class="item-text">
<p>The Police Chief of Qom Province Second Brigadier General Abdolreza Aghakhani said on Tuesday that the police forces of the province confiscated 1.006 tons of illicit drugs and opium in collaboration with police forces of Lorestan Province.</p>
<p>The smuggler was planning to transfer the consignment to Qom province, he added.</p>
<p>One smuggler has been arrested and one vehicle seized during the operation, according to the police chief.</p>
<p>The Islamic Republic has been actively fighting drug-trafficking over the past three decades, despite its high economic and human costs. The war on drug trade originating from Afghanistan has claimed the lives of nearly 4,000 Iranian police officers over the past four decades. The country has spent more than hundreds of millions of dollars on sealing its borders and preventing the transit of narcotics destined for European, Arab and Central Asian countries.</p>

										<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>Iran’s Qom to Host Ceremony to Honor Nigeria’s Zakzaky</p>
<p>According To <a href="https://irannewsdaily.com/">Iran News</a>, Iran’s holy city of Qom is slated to host a ceremony to honor the top Shiite cleric and leader of the Islamic Movement in Nigeria (IMN) Sheikh Ibrahim al-Zakzaky.</p>
<p>The commemoration ceremony of Sheikh Zakzaky will be held at the shrine of Hazrat Masoumah (AS) in Iran&#8217;s central city of Qom on Thursday.</p>
<p>Ayatollah Mohsen Araki, a member of the Assembly of Experts, plans to deliver the keynote address at the ceremony.</p>
<p>Sheikh Zakzaky has been held in detention since December 2015 and was charged just in April 2018 with murder, culpable homicide, unlawful assembly, disruption of public peace and other accusations. He has pleaded not guilty.</p>
<p>In 2016, Nigeria’s federal high court ordered his unconditional release from jail following a trial, but the government has so far refused to set him free.</p>
<p>The top cleric, who is in his mid-sixties, lost his left eyesight in a raid which was carried out by the Nigerian army on his residence in the northern town of Zaria in December 2015.</p>
<p>During the raid, Zakzaky’s wife sustained serious wounds too and more than 300 of his followers and three of his sons were killed. Zakzaky, his wife, and a large number of the cleric’s followers have since been in custody.</p>

										<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p class="summary">TEHRAN (<a href="https://irannewsdaily.com/" target="_blank" rel="noopener noreferrer">Iran News</a>) – Majlis Speaker Ali Larijani says he will not run for re-election in the upcoming parliamentary elections.</p>
<p>“I represented the noble people of Qom for three terms, which has been an honor for me,” Larijani said on Saturday, according to ILNA.</p>
<p>Larijani added that “however, in general, I do not have any plans to be present in the next Majlis (parliament) and will not run for re-election.”</p>
<p>Parliamentary elections will be held on Feb. 21, 2020 with the approval of the Guardian Council</p>
<p>The midterm elections of the Assembly of Experts will also be held on the same date in Tehran, Khorasan Razavi, North Khorasan, Fars and Qom provinces.</p>
<p>Under Article 99 of Iran’s Constitution, the responsibility to supervise elections lays with the Guardian Council.</p>
<p>The body consists of six theologians appointed by the Leader and six jurists nominated by the Judiciary and approved by parliament.</p>
<p>Touching upon a plan to impeach the speaker, Hossein-Ali Haji-Deligani said, “The speakers’ performance caused Majlis not to stand atop all affairs.”</p>
<p>“The speaker has done a number of illegal violations whose last one is announcing his own private vote for gas price rise in the Supreme Economic Coordination Council, which includes heads of the three branches of the government, without consulting the representatives’ views,” Haji-Deligani have told earlier about Ali Larijani.</p>
<p>“In the meantime, the government optionally implements only those ratifications of the Majlis that it wants which is nothing but ignorance of legislators’ ratifications,” added Haji-Deligani, who represents Shahin Shahr and Meymeh in the parliament.</p>

										<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>The Police Commander of East of Tehran, Kiumars Azizi said on Tuesday that the police forces seized two consignments of illegal drugs in Qom &#8211; Garmsar Freeway during two separate operations.</p>
<p>273kg opium was seized during operations and three smugglers were arrested and have been handed over to the judicial officials, he added.</p>
<p>Recently, the spokesperson of Iran Drug Control Headquarters said that 298,172 kg of illicit drugs have been identified and confiscated by Iranian anti-narcotics police in various operations in the first four months of the current Iranian calendar year (March 21 – July 21), adding that the level of drug discoveries have increased 7 percent compared to the corresponding period last year.</p>
<p>Iran is at the forefront of the fight against drug trafficking and thousands of Iranian forces have been so far martyred to protect the world from the danger of drugs.</p>
<p>According to reports, in 2018 alone, Iranian forces carried out 1,557 operations against drug traffickers, seizing approximately 807 tons of different types of narcotic drugs and psychotropic substances.</p>
<p>According to the World Drug Report 2019” of the United Nations Office on Drugs and Crime, in 2017, Iran had seized the largest quantity of opiates, accounting for 39% of the global total.</p>
